Origin and Etymology of concept
Latin conceptum, neuter of conceptus, past participle of concipere to conceive — more at conceive
First Known Use: 1556

Definition of concept
1 : organized around a main idea or theme <a concept album>
2 : created to illustrate a concept <a concept car>
Origin and Etymology of concept
see 1concept
First Known Use: 1896
